The Science Behind Extended Fasting and Metabolic Shifts

Extended fasting initiates several metabolic adaptations within the body. Initially, the body relies on stored glucose, known as glycogen, for energy. This stored glycogen is bound with water, so its depletion contributes to early weight reduction.

Once glycogen stores are significantly reduced, typically within 24-48 hours, the body shifts its primary energy source to stored fat. This metabolic state, known as ketosis, involves the liver converting fatty acids into ketone bodies, which cells then use for fuel.

Initial Weight Loss: Water and Glycogen

During the first few days of a fast, a substantial portion of the weight lost comes from water and glycogen. Each gram of glycogen stores approximately 3-4 grams of water. As these carbohydrate reserves are used up, the associated water is released and excreted.

This early weight change is often quite noticeable on the scale but does not represent a direct loss of body fat. It signifies the body transitioning from carbohydrate-burning to fat-burning metabolism.

Fat Adaptation and Ketosis

After glycogen depletion, the body enters a state of fat adaptation. This means it becomes more efficient at burning fat for energy. Ketone bodies, produced from fat, become a primary fuel source for the brain and other tissues.

Sustained ketosis during an extended fast promotes consistent fat oxidation. The rate of fat loss depends on an individual’s total energy deficit, which is influenced by their metabolic rate and physical activity during the fast.

Understanding 12 Day Fast Weight Loss: What to Expect

The total weight loss experienced during a 12-day fast varies considerably among individuals. Factors such as starting body weight, body composition, metabolic rate, and activity levels all play a role. It is not uncommon for individuals to see a reduction ranging from 0.5 to 1 pound of body fat per day once the initial water and glycogen loss has occurred.

This consistent fat loss contributes to the overall weight reduction observed over the 12-day period. The body uses its fat reserves to meet daily energy requirements, leading to a caloric deficit.

  • Individual Variability: Metabolic rates differ, influencing how quickly fat is metabolized.
  • Starting Body Composition: Individuals with higher body fat percentages may experience a greater absolute fat loss.
  • Activity Levels: While intense exercise is generally not recommended during extended fasts, light activity can contribute to energy expenditure.

Hydration and Electrolyte Planning

Maintaining proper hydration and electrolyte balance is paramount during any extended fast. Water alone is not sufficient; essential minerals are lost through urine and sweat. The National Institutes of Health provides extensive research on the importance of these micronutrients for bodily function, stating that imbalances can lead to adverse effects. “National Institutes of Health”

Replenishing electrolytes like sodium, potassium, and magnesium is non-negotiable. Many people use electrolyte supplements or create their own solutions using mineral salts.

  1. Sodium: Essential for fluid balance and nerve function. Use unrefined sea salt in water.
  2. Potassium: Important for heart health and muscle function. Look for potassium chloride supplements or cream of tartar.
  3. Magnesium: Crucial for over 300 enzymatic reactions, including energy production. Magnesium citrate or glycinate are common forms.
Electrolyte Typical Daily Need (Fasting) Source Examples
Sodium 2,000-5,000 mg Unrefined Sea Salt
Potassium 1,000-3,000 mg Potassium Chloride, Cream of Tartar
Magnesium 300-500 mg Magnesium Glycinate/Citrate

Breaking the Fast Safely: The Re-feeding Process

The re-feeding period following an extended fast is as important as the fast itself. Introducing food too quickly or in large quantities can overwhelm the digestive system and lead to discomfort or more serious complications. This period requires patience and careful food choices.

Start with small, easily digestible portions. Bone broth is an excellent first choice, providing electrolytes and amino acids without taxing the digestive system. Fermented foods, like a small amount of sauerkraut, can also help reintroduce beneficial gut bacteria.

  • Day 1-2: Focus on liquids and very soft foods. Bone broth, diluted vegetable juice, and very small amounts of steamed non-starchy vegetables.
  • Day 3-4: Gradually introduce easily digestible proteins and healthy fats. Small portions of eggs, avocado, or lean fish.
  • Day 5+: Slowly reintroduce complex carbohydrates and a wider variety of whole foods. Continue to monitor digestive response.
Re-feeding Stage Recommended Foods Avoided Foods
Initial (Day 1-2) Bone broth, diluted vegetable juice, fermented foods (small amounts) Large meals, raw vegetables, sugar, processed foods
Intermediate (Day 3-4) Soft proteins (eggs, fish), healthy fats (avocado), cooked non-starchy vegetables Dairy, nuts, seeds, legumes, gluten
Gradual Reintroduction (Day 5+) Slowly add complex carbs (quinoa, sweet potato), nuts, seeds, legumes Overeating, highly processed items, excessive sugar

Important Considerations and When to Seek Guidance

Extended fasting is not suitable for everyone. Certain health conditions or medications may make a 12-day fast unsafe. Individuals with a history of eating disorders, those who are pregnant or breastfeeding, or those with chronic illnesses like diabetes or heart conditions should avoid extended fasting.

It is always prudent to discuss any plans for extended fasting with a healthcare professional. They can offer personalized advice based on individual health status and ensure the approach is appropriate and safe. Self-monitoring for any adverse symptoms is also essential during the fast.

  • Individuals with pre-existing medical conditions
  • Those taking prescription medications
  • Pregnant or breastfeeding individuals
  • Individuals with a history of eating disorders
  • Individuals who are underweight
